Dear Achiya,

thank you for your email. You downloaded the correct version and it
should have worked.
I tested the fix from ticket #1652 again and as it turns out this only
fixes the problem with the system locale setting for non-Unicode
programs. The resizing issue for display settings that are configured
to a font size of 125% or higher still exists. I am guessing that you
hit both bugs as your system locale setting is probably Hebrew and
when i remember correctly your font size is set to 125%.
So there is still one problem left to fix, i have created a ticket
(#1688) and we will try to solve this as soon as possible.

Dear Achiya and Yael,

we have finally found and fixed the ui resizing issues that you have
experienced in HeuristicLab. The fix is currently in the trunk version
of HeuristicLab and will be part of the next release (3.3.7) which is
scheduled for the end of June. If you need the fix immediately you can
use the HeuristicLab daily build from [0] which already includes the
bugfix. But be warned that this is the development version and
therefore may not be as stable as the release version.
